Output 8c605b84cf8d3ce72d63577d2d5e27d5c73e25cfbbd7dfc054b69b4da4d2cd70:0

value
37953
script pubkey
OP_0 OP_PUSHBYTES_20 ea4f0f52dbca691e19aa12e39263933428c26a79
address
bc1qaf8s75kmef53uxd2zt3eycunxs5vy6nehjap6z
transaction
8c605b84cf8d3ce72d63577d2d5e27d5c73e25cfbbd7dfc054b69b4da4d2cd70
confirmations
98592
spent
true